1
私は最初のvim関数(隠し文字を切り替える)を書こうとしています。 これは私がそれを実行したときしかし、私はエラー無効な関数showHiddenChars 任意の提案を取得し、私がこれまで持っているもの最初のvim関数 - 無効な関数
set nolist
set listchars=space:_,tab:▸\ ,eol:¬
nnoremap <leader>c :call showHiddenChars()<cr> "<---Calling function here
let g:showhiddenChars_is_visible = 0
function! showHiddenChars()
if g:showhiddenChars_is_visible
set nolist
let g:showhiddenChars_is_visible = 0
else
set list
let g:showhiddenChars_is_visible = 1
endif
endfunction
です。これは私の最初のvim関数です。
ちょっとおっしゃるように、 ':set list! 'コマンドの後にbangを追加するだけで、これをすべてする必要はありません。 –